Neiman May Seek Sanctions Over Creditor's Alleged Meddling
By Vince Sullivan ( August 24, 2020, 10:13 PM EDT) -- Attorneys for bankrupt retailer Neiman Marcus told a Texas judge Monday that it may pursue Chapter 11 sanctions against unsecured creditor Marble Ridge Capital after the federal bankruptcy watchdog accused the creditor of meddling in a potential asset sale last week in breach of its fiduciary duties to other unsecured creditors....
